Editor's Note: In 1992 the Maidencreek Township Authority (see Art. II of this chapter) became full successor in interest to the Maidencreek Water Authority. The Township Board of Supervisors ratified the 1992 transfer of assets and undertaking of responsibilities on 7-28-2008 by Res. No. 15-2008, the text of which is on file in the Township offices.

The Board of Supervisors of the Township are
hereby directed to cause a notice of the substance of this article,
including the substance of the proposed Articles of Incorporation
and of the proposed filing of the above Articles of Incorporation
to be published once in the Berks County Law Journal, and once in
a newspaper published and of general circulation in Berks County,
as required by the Municipality Authorities Act of 1945, as amended.
The Chairman and the Secretary of the Board
of Supervisors are directed to file said Articles of Incorporation,
together with the necessary proofs of publication, with the Secretary
of the Commonwealth, and to do all other acts and things necessary
or appropriate to effect the incorporation of Maidencreek Township
Water Authority.
The initial project which shall be undertaken
by the said Authority is: to acquire, hold, construct, improve, maintain,
operate, own, lease, either as lessor or as lessee, water works, water
supply works, and water distribution systems for Maidencreek Township
and for such other territory as it may be authorized to serve.

The Chairman of the Board of Supervisors and
the Secretary, respectively, of this Township further are directed
to cause notice of the substance of this article, including the substance
of the foregoing Articles of Incorporation, and of the proposed filing
of such Articles of Incorporation to be published as required by the
Act.
The Chairman of the Board of Supervisors and
the Secretary, respectively, of this Township further are directed
to cause such Articles of Incorporation, together with the necessary
proofs of publication, to be filed with the Secretary of the Commonwealth
of Pennsylvania, and to do all other acts and things necessary or
appropriate to effect the incorporation of such Authority, including
payment of any filing fees required in connection therewith.
